I thought this was a very strange game, especially the first half. First the Broncos throw it incomplete two straight times from the one yard line and kick a field goal. The next time down they run it 3 straight times from the 1. Then Manning throws a block and goes to the locker room after the Broncos seemingly scored a touchdown, but hold on a second he didn't actually get in it's 4th and goal. Here I think the Broncos blew it by not going for it on 4th and goal. Yes, even with Manning in the locker room getting an iv I would have put Brock in their for the qb sneak. Worst case scenario he's stuffed and the Chargers are backed up to their own goal line in a game the Broncos defense has dominated.

The offensive play calling to end the half was awful, IMO. Why in the world did they have Brock try to throw the ball? I don't really put much blame on Brock, that was a tough situation to come into, but the Broncos should have run the ball 3 straight times and gone to the locker room up 9-0. But they didn't, and the Broncos had to punt, and Royal got a great return. Fortunately the defense stepped up and bailed out the coaching staff on that one.

Overall, I thought the Broncos secondary had it's best game of the season. The Broncos didn't get any pass rush (give credit to the Chargers line as it looked like the Broncos tried several blitzes that just didn't get through) but the secondary really locked up the Chargers receivers. They won this game IMO.

It wasn't pretty, but the Broncos won a tough road game against a good division rival. Of course there are things to be critical of, but in my opinion winning a game like that on the road is a good sign going forward. One more road game to go, and if we win that one we lock up a first round bye, which I think is crucial for this banged up team.

So first injury update of the day. Ryan Clady has a quad injury but does not look like anything serious. Should be ready by this Sunday.


Brandon Marshall is one that is hard to completely understand. it is a mild foot sprain which could mean a wide range of things. Such as Ronnie Hillman had a mild foot sprain back in the middle of November and has yet to return. Champ Bailey had a foot sprain (lis franc) and missed almost the entire season. So not sure yet how serious it is if he will be week by week or out the rest of the season.
